Transaction 7541621d61b831da37a4655c41629b4abdd77a2f15f05d940e13a6a8841d5d2d

1 Input
2 Outputs
  • 7541621d61b831da37a4655c41629b4abdd77a2f15f05d940e13a6a8841d5d2d:0
  • value  1000516
    address  1Fj9S2w9BXCtBzwzyTRWeJuShMbxD1U19Q
  • 7541621d61b831da37a4655c41629b4abdd77a2f15f05d940e13a6a8841d5d2d:1
  • value  135510
    address  1DSttMmFWh5ZenF42Au692iWZoS6h76ZgQ